Strengthening the resilience, sustainability and impact of your organisation
The Anthony Costa Foundation, in partnership with Benefolk, is pleased to invite not-for-profit organisations based in or working in the Geelong/G21 region to participate in the upcoming Strength in Community Workshop.
This day long facilitated workshop will help organisations identify their strengths, challenges and future priorities, through a structured capability assessment process. Participants will received a tailored diagnostic report and have the opportunity to explore future capability- building support through the organisational steam of the Foundation’s Strength in Community Grant Program.

Why Participate
-Complete a structured capability diagnostic across key areas such as strategy, governance, financial sustainability and organisational effectiveness
-Receive a tailored report highlighting their organisation’s capability strengths and development needs
-Connect with peers from across the Geelong community sector
-Gain insight into broader sector trends and capability challenges
-Contribute to a shared understanding of organisational needs across the Geelong region
-Explore opportunities for future capability-building support
This workshop is the first step in the Foundation’s Organisational Stream process. Organisations that participate will be invited to submit an Expression of Interest (EOI) seeking support to address capability priorities identified through the assessment.
